Study Summary

The goal of this study is to conduct a pilot feasibility study a novel informatics intervention, GlucoType (also called Platano for Latino users) that incorporates computational analysis of self-monitoring data to help individuals with type 2 diabetes personalize diabetes self-management strategies. This study will include 20 individuals with type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) recruited from economically disadvantaged and medically underserved communities to test Platano for 4 weeks to assess its acceptability and feasibility. The main outcome measures include problem-solving abilities in diabetes (Diabetes Problem-Solving Inventory (DPSA)) and self-reported diabetes self-care (Summary of Diabetes Self-Care Activities Questionnaire (SDSCA)). In addition, this study will include a controlled laboratory experiment to assess whether participants can understand and follow personalized nutritional goals generated by Platano.
